Lady Jays place sixth at Lawton tournament; Brown, Reyes sign college letters

The Guthrie High School Lady Jays golf team competed Monday at Lawton Country Club, finishing sixth overall against a competitive field.

Guthrie posted a team score of 381. Duncan took first place with a 341, followed by McGuinness (350), Carl Albert (360), Blanchard (370), and Lawton MacArthur (378).

Senior Tatum Brown led the Lady Jays with a sixth-place finish, carding an 82. Sophomore Mallory Lemon finished 16th with a 93, while senior Taegan Reyes placed 34th with a score of 100.

Senior Maely Beeby finished 48th with a 107, and freshman Olivia Riley placed 47th with a 106.

The strong senior leadership has been a key storyline for Guthrie this season. Brown has already signed to continue her golf career at Murray State College, while Reyes recently signed with Cottey College.
